Historical & Cultural Background

The name Sarae is derived from the Hebrew name Sarah, which means 'princess' and has biblical significance as the wife of Abraham. It is a name that has been used in various cultures, often associated with nobility and leadership. In English-speaking countries, Sarae is considered a modern variant of Sarah, reflecting contemporary naming trends.

U.S. Historical Usage

The name Sarae was first seen in the United States in 1969. Sarae has ranked as high as #1362 nationally, which occurred in 2007, and has been most popular in Florida. In the past 5 years the name Sarae has been trending about the same compared to the previous 5 years.
